What is a Remote Securiti AI job?

A Remote Securiti AI job involves working with artificial intelligence tools and technologies to help organizations manage data privacy, compliance, and security risks, all while working remotely. Professionals in these roles typically use Securiti.ai’s platform to automate data discovery, privacy compliance, and security processes across cloud and on-premise environments. They may analyze data flows, monitor regulatory requirements, and help implement data protection solutions, often collaborating with cross-functional teams from a distance. These jobs are ideal for those with a background in cybersecurity, data privacy, or AI, who prefer remote work arrangements.

Job description

Exciting Remote Securiti.ai SME contract career opportunity.
Own the design, configuration and operationalization of the Securiti.ai platform for an enterprise privacy-compliance program - turning DSAR, DPIA, RoPA and consent requirements into a working, defensible capability the client can run after transition.
Requirements
  • 2+ years hands-on Securiti.ai - discovery & classification, DSAR automation, DPIA, RoPA, consent modules
  • Multi-cloud connector configuration: AWS, Azure, GCP, Oracle Cloud, IBM Cloud; SaaS sources incl. M365 & Salesforce
  • Architect and configure the Securiti.ai Data Command Center - discovery, classification and data-mapping modules across the multi-cloud estate
  • Stand up DSAR intake and fulfillment automation, DPIA/PIA workflows, RoPA and Universal Consent Management
  • Map cross-border transfer obligations and EU AI Act touchpoints into the platform's assessment framework
  • Integrate with the surrounding stack - DSPM, data catalog, CMDB and SaaS sources - and tune classification accuracy
  • Deliver runbooks, role-based training and knowledge transfer for client self-sufficiency.
  • Working fluency in GDPR, CCPA/CPRA and U.S. state privacy laws; EU AI Act awareness
  • Experience operationalizing DSAR SLAs, records of processing and consent at enterprise scale
  • Data mapping and lineage across structured/unstructured stores; Databricks & ServiceNow CMDB familiarity a plus
  • API-based integration experience; DSPM tooling exposure (e.g., Wiz, Microsoft Purview) valued
  • Preferred: Securiti.ai certification(s) - Privacy Ops / Data Command Center, IAPP CIPP/E, CIPM or CIPT; CISSP or equivalent security credential a plus
